Testing the Installation of the
GasTrac
1
Start the Energy Smart Dryer,
see Operation Section, Starting the Dryer.
Monitor the dryer during the first few minutes of operation to verify that the
start-up operating sequences are correct.
2
Turn on the gas supply to the GasTrac.
All manual shut-off valves in the gas
supply line and the GasTrac’s fuel train must be in the open position. Before
proceeding, use a detection device or soapy water to check for gas leaks in the
GasTrac’s fuel train.
3
Turn on main power to the GasTrac.
Turn the main disconnect dial to the ON
position. If everything is installed correctly, the variable speed control’s display
will illuminate.
4
Press the Power switch to ON.
• The Power ON/OFF switch illuminates.
• The temperature controller begins a 3-second self-test. The display will flash
between STANDBY and the setpoint temperature.
• The Burner Controller begins a 10-second initiation, which ends when the
display indicates STANDBY.
5
Set the drying temperature.
Press the up or down arrow on the temperature
controller until 250°F appears in the lower display.
6
Press the “RUN” button.
• The green RUN light will illuminate after the Burner Controller finishes
initializing.
• The combustion blower will start and run for 90 seconds to purge any residual
gas from the burner. (Check blower rotation at this time - See Step 7).
• After the 90-second purge, the burner will ignite on low fire (low blower
speed) for about 15 seconds. The burner will then go to high fire and gradual-
ly settle at a lower setting to maintain the setpoint temperature.
NOTE: BURNER START UP
If the burner fails to ignite and
the red alarm light illuminates,
there may still be air in the gas
lines. Check the burner con-
troller display. If the alarm LED
is illuminated, press the
“Reset” button on the front of
the electrical enclosure. If not,
refer to the Troubleshooting
section of the GasTrac User
Guide and the burner controller
manual.
